Message:

#2709

  • Added Check Inputs/All/None buttons instead of showing disabled buttons of the ItemCollectionView.
  • Removed the PreprocessingCheckedItemListView. A standard ListView is used instead.
  • Fixed slow updating when simultaneously (un-)checking multiple variables in the chart views. (currently only works by using the new buttons)
